The Chilliwack Visual Artists Association presentsMaxwell NewhouseMaxwell Newhouse has a passion for expressing himself creatively in both painting and writing. A resident of Chilliwack, he has shown his artwork in galleries across Canada, and has written and illustrated several books for children. In 2006, his book, Let's Go for a Ride was nominated for the Governor General Award for Children's Illustration. His latest book, Counting on Snow (published by Tundra Books) was officially launched on January 15 at the Chilliwack Art Gallery. His book invites children to count down from ten crunching caribou to one lonely moose, by finding other northern animals as they turn the pages. The exhibition Home, Community and Northern Wildlife is comprised of artwork from three of his delightful books.Gallery Hours: 12:00 – 5:00 PM (Wed-Sat) January 15 – February 17, 2011

The Chilliwack Lions Club presentsCHILLIWACK LIONS CLUB MUSIC AND DANCE FESTIVALThis Festival provides opportunities for those in the Fraser Valley, Lower

Mainland, and Vancouver, to perform and receive encouragement as emerging artists. The Cultural Centre is the main venue for the many divisions of the festival, excluding the Organ (Chilliwack United Church) and Bands (G.W. Graham Middle School). There are 1,650 entries with over 4,600 participants with ages 5-20 years. Our music division also accommodates adult entries.

Performers receive written and oral critique from some of Canada’s top professional adjudicators. Master classes and workshops are offered in the different disciplines and age categories. We offer awards, trophies, and scholarships of encouragement. The Chilliwack Arts & Cultural Centre Society presentsBILLY BISHOP GOES TO WARThis classic Canadian musical asks a new generation of theatre audiences to follow heroic Canadian WW1 fighter pilot Billy Bishop down into the trenches, up to the skies and inside the human spirit as he attempts to reconcile the ecstasy of flying with the horrors of war. The myth of the man is revealed as he tells of crossing swords with commanders, the Germans, the British and those who saw war as a good time. You will be thrilled by this rich, humourous, and moving tribute to a true Canadian hero. This high-flying ace of a show captures the humor, the hellfire, and the derring-do of an extraordinary career.
